Special Nature Discoveries

For those who want to learn more about nature, special day trips are designed to ficus more upon education then adventure. These are definitely unique learning experiences that are designed to increase our understanding and appreciation of nature. Guided by local interpretive experts in natural and cultural history, these thematic tours take us on an ecotour to find out more of the plants and animals with whom we share a place. A Landscape in Motion
A field study looking at the dynamic procession of geology and glaciology within Kluane.
 
Wildlife of Kluane
What you see and what sees you are two different things. Learn how to see and identify wildlife.

  The Art of Nature
A close examintaion of the form and function of living and non-living things demonstrating the interconnectedness of the natural world.
 
"Night Light - A Photographic Odyssey"
A special tour offered from June to mid-July when we experience 24 hours of day light/ Enjoy the "Midnight Sun" and sounds of the forest as birds and wild animals come to life during the twilight hours between sunset and sunrise and more!
